About Kelvinator

It’s a slogan you first encountered while watching TV as a kid: "Australians love a Kelvinator." The technology has changed over the years, but the promise of quality and simple usability hasn’t budged. Kelvinator appliances are made for Australian conditions – for slaying the summer swelter and for warding off the winter chill.

Kelvinator was founded in 1914 by engineer Nathaniel B. Wales in Detroit, Michigan. The name was derived from Lord Kelvin, the physicist responsible for the concept of absolute zero. Wales’ dream was a practical electric refrigeration unit for the home, which would outperform the vapour-compression units and iceboxes that were popular at the time.

By 1926, Kelvinator fridges were being imported to Australia. It was around this time that the company was establishing a reputation as innovators in their field. The fridges you use today in your home and workplace rely on technology that was instituted by Kelvinator. The first two-door refrigerator? That was Kelvinator. The first fridge with any sort of automatic control? You guessed it: Kelvinator.

Today, Kelvinator is proud to belong to the Electrolux group of appliances. Catering to families all around the country, and to homes of all sizes, a Kelvinator fridge or air-conditioner will help you to combat the elements.
